Understanding Treadmill Behavior: What’s Normal vs. What’s Not
Treadmills are one of the most popular pieces of equipment in gyms, homes, and other places where people work out. You can often hear them humming along in homes and gyms all over Kuwait. But if a treadmill starts to change speed without any input, like slowing down or speeding up suddenly, this is more than just a quirk; it could mean that something is seriously wrong. This kind of strange behaviour could be caused by problems with the circuit board, worn-out motors, speed sensors that don't work right, or even problems with the belt tension. High temperatures and dust exposure in Kuwait can put even more stress on the parts of your treadmill. If you don't fix these small technical problems, they could get worse over time and cause the machine to break down completely.

Signs You Should Call a Technician Immediately
Don’t wait until the treadmill stops completely. Here are warning signs that demand immediate technician intervention:
- Treadmill belt slips or jerks while in motion
- Burning smell or excessive heat from the motor
- Unresponsive speed or incline buttons
- Error codes on the console
- Sudden speed changes without input
In many cases, these signs are signs of bigger problems, like a motor that isn't working or electrical problems. Some people try to fix their treadmills themselves, but they are complicated machines. If you don't have the right tools or training, you could make the problem worse or void your warranty.
